KANSAS CITY POWER & LIGHT CO. v. DIR. OF REV.

Nos. 71566, 71653.

783 S.W.2d 910 (1990)

KANSAS CITY POWER & LIGHT COMPANY, etc., Appellant, v. DIRECTOR OF REVENUE, Respondent. (Consolidated with) UNION ELECTRIC COMPANY, Appellant, v. DIRECTOR OF REVENUE,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Missouri, En Banc.

February 13, 1990.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Steven R. Sullivan and Barbara A. Enneking, St. Louis, for Union Elec. Co.

Robert P. Gingrich, Jr., Kansas City, for Kansas City Power & Light Co.

William L. Webster, Atty. Gen. and Mark S. Siedlik, Asst. Atty. Gen., Jefferson City, for respondent.


BLACKMAR, Chief Justice.

The petitioners in this consolidated case are utilities solely engaged in the generation of electric current which is sold to individual and business consumers. They consume a portion of the power they generate at their own installations, which include offices, plants, garages, and storage facilities.
